Franklin's Subs and Suds is located on St-Paul street in Old-Montreal. Delicious "Philly Cheesesteak" submarines are the main attraction. The decor is very comforting, you'll find arcades, beautifully designed graffiti and great ambient music.
Reviews describe a lively casual spot in the Old Port with strong drinks, quick service and a menu that shines on smoked meat sandwiches, poutine and burgers, delivering solid value and a welcoming vibe. The atmosphere ranges from cozy to energetic, aided by retro decor, music and a bar scene that makes it easy to hang out. The staff are described as attentive and friendly, providing fast service and helpful recommendations. While experiences are mostly positive, some notes mention crowding, noise and occasional variability in dishes such as the poutine. Overall Franklin's is seen as a reliable choice for lunch or a casual night out in Montreal, offering memorable smoked meat and good drinks with a lively social vibe.

Franklin's is one of the only restaurants in Montreal where you can eat at a wallet-friendly price. That alone gives it a lot of value. Straying away from the bourgeoise aesthetic of the old port restaurants, Franklins presents itself as the sort of casual bar/restaurant you might find along on St. Denis. They claim to have the best philly cheesesteaks in Montreal. There isn't much competition in this ring, but comparing to philly cheesesteaks I've had elsewhere, this is actually probably a valid claim. They definitely do the sandwich justice. The server was an exceptional bartender, my party was in agreement that the drinks exceeded the food in quality.
